Monsoon advances, set to bring relief from heatwave in North India

The monsoon arrived nearly two days ahead of schedule in the western state of Maharashtra, home to the commercial capital of Mumbai, but its progress in central and eastern states of the country stalled for nearly a week.

The Southwest monsoon is advancing after stalling for more than a week and rains are set to cover central parts of the country in the next few days, bringing relief from the heatwave in the grain-growing northern plains, agencies reported quoting senior officials from from MeT department.

The southwest monsoon is gathering pace and is expected to progress further in the coming days, providing much-needed relief to north India, which is reeling under an intense heatwave.

Summer rains, critical for economic growth in Asia's third-largest economy, usually begin in the south around June 1 before spreading nationwide by July 8, allowing farmers to plant crops such as rice, cotton, soybeans, and sugarcane.

The monsoon arrived nearly two days ahead of schedule in the western state of Maharashtra, home to the commercial capital of Mumbai, but its progress in central and eastern states of the country stalled for nearly a week.

The lifeblood of the nearly $3.5-trillion economy, the monsoon brings nearly 70% of the rain India needs to water farms and refill reservoirs and aquifers. In the absence of irrigation, nearly half the farmland in the world's second-biggest producer of rice, wheat and sugar depends on the annual rains that usually run from June to September.

India has received 20 per cent less rainfall since the start of the monsoon period on June 1, with the rain-bearing system making no significant progress between June 12 and 18.

On Tuesday the IMD said that June will receive below-normal rainfall.

June and July are considered the most important monsoon months for agriculture because most of the sowing for the Kharif crop takes place during this period.
